Detailed Description |
|
The tomb of the "Rabh" (R. Ephraim Ankawa) in the Jewish cemetery on the outskirts of Tlemcen is an important place of pilgrimage for Jews and non-Jews. Sometimes more than 10,000 people from many parts of the world convened there on Lag ba-Omer.
